The floral Serapi sits one step closer to the Tabriz court tradition than its open-field cousins. The drawing pulls in palmettes, vines, and rosettes from the Safavid garden vocabulary, then loosens them into the larger scale and flatter colour blocking that the Heriz district is known for. The rust ground gives the design its weight. The red carries the weave forward across the room without leaning on the medallion alone.
Hand-knotted in India over roughly five months by three weavers working a vertical loom in coordinated rows. The wool is hand-carded and hand-spun, which leaves a faint irregularity in the yarn diameter that catches light differently on every knot. Dyes are prepared from madder root for the rust, indigo for the deeper blue tones, and walnut hull for the soft browns in the borders. Each dye lot is matured for two to three weeks before the wool is lowered, and the small variations between batches are what give the field its slow tonal movement.
The composition
A radial floral medallion in cream and indigo set against a saturated red and rust field. Corner spandrels echo the medallion in mirror. The main border carries a layered floral repeat in indigo and cream. The red is not flat. It shifts between brick, garnet, and old-rose along the length of the rug as the dye lots change, an effect celebrated rather than corrected in this tradition. The pattern reads at a distance and reveals its drawing on approach.

Conservation
Rotate twice a year so light and wear distribute evenly. Vacuum weekly on suction only, beater bar off. Blot spills immediately with a dry cotton cloth and follow with a slightly damp cloth if needed. Schedule a hand-wash by a wool-trained conservator every five years. With this care the carpet runs eighty years and beyond.

Day-to-day care
- Vacuum gently once a week without a rotating brush bar — use the suction-only setting on hand-knotted or hand-tufted pieces.
- Rotate the rug 180° every 3-6 months so foot traffic and sunlight wear is even.
- Use a quality rug pad underneath for slip resistance and to extend life.
- Blot fresh spills immediately with a clean white cloth — do not rub. Work from the edge of the spill inward.
Deep cleaning
- Professional dry-cleaning is recommended every 12-24 months for hand-knotted carpets.
- Avoid steam cleaners and hot water on natural-fibre rugs (wool, silk, jute) — they can cause shrinkage and dye bleeding.
- For washable flat-weaves and cotton dhurries, machine-wash on a gentle cold cycle in a mesh bag.
Storage
- Roll (do not fold) the carpet around a clean cardboard tube, pile-side in.
- Wrap in breathable cotton sheeting (not plastic) and store in a cool, dry, well-ventilated space.
- Use moth-protection sachets if storing wool for more than a season.
